Click the “Save As” type drop-down list, and then select “Word Template (*. DOTX)” as the file type. Enable the “Save Thumbnail” option, then click the “Save” button. If Microsoft Word displays a warning message about saving the file in a new format, click the “OK” button.
Click Start, point to All Programs, click Microsoft Office, click Microsoft Office Tools, and then click Digital Certificate for VBA Projects. The Create Digital Certificate box appears. In the Your certificate's name box, type a descriptive name for the certificate. Click OK.

docx file type is for a standard Word document which contains no macros. The . dotx file type is used for templates from which new documents are generated. It cannot contain macros, either.

Open Word and select New. In the Search text box, type Certificate to filter for certificate templates. Choose a template, then select Create. The certificate opens as a new document.
Various word processors, including Microsoft Word, Apple Pages, and LibreOffice Writer, can convert DOTX files to other formats. For example, in the Windows and Mac versions of Microsoft Word, select File → Save As to convert DOTX files to one of the following formats: . DOCX - Microsoft Word Document.
